From Amazon.com: "Trapshooting," stresses James Russell in this comprehensive instructional for the sport, "can be summed up as vivid images and feel, not complex technicalities." Despite that essential sensorial caveat, his Bible is filled with exactly the kind of technical tips and practice drills necessary for improving a shooter's skills, concentration, and focus. Though Precision Shooting emphasizes the importance of the basics--set-up, point of impact, timing, visualization, and gun fit--it is no simple primer. Aimed at the advanced trapshooter and those who aspire to that status, it is dense with details, drills, specifications, and 315 exhaustive answers to 315 FAQ that are made even denser by their presentation, which is dreary at best. Heavy on abnormally large blocks of text, Precision Shooting inexplicably consigns its substantial grouping of helpful illustrations and diagrams to a single section in the rear instead of integrating them throughout. Still, if your target is ratcheting up your shooting skills, the Bible offers chapter and verse. --Jeff Silverman
Look closely at the other reviews...: It seems rather odd that the overwhelming majority of reviews (all of which award this book 5 stars) are anonymous postings from Livingston, Texas. A quick internet search reveals that the author, James Russell, lives in Livingston. In fact, one review for this book is written by a "James Russell" from Livingston, though the reviewer states that he is "new to trap shooting and 56 years of age" It seems clear that Mr. Livingston is anonlymously writing reviews for his own book and giving it five stars to boost its ratings. If the book were really as good as he claims it is, one wonders why it would be necessary to falsely boost the ratings. Interestingly, a search on Amazon of James Russell's other books, such as those on screenwriting display the same tendency: many laudatory 5-star reviews from Livingston, TX, including some from the author, who claims to have benefited greatly from the wisdom of the book. Strange indeed!

Buyer beware.: While this book offers many sound trapshooting points, they come amidst a sea of personal opinion, Christian evangelizing, and the marketing of other books. This book is self-published and begs for professional editing. There are countless glowing spelling and grammatical errors. If one were to eliminate the redundancy and material not related to the subject, this rather expensive book would barely reach 100 pages. And, as if the contents were all his original ideas, he offers no bibliographic reference for any of the opinions, facts, or conclusions, even though many are contrary to conventional trapshooting wisdom and instruction. While Russell is quick to point out that the book is only useful if kept constantly on hand during practice and competition, he also sells it as an e-book that cannot be printed. All things considered, I have to seriously question the accuracy of the material and the validity of Mr. Russell's opinions.
